Mommiles, are define as “sermons, especially intended to edify a child on everything that matters.” How many of these were said to you?

My mother taught me individuality. “I don’t care how many of your friends are getting their tattoos, you’re not!”
My mother taught me patience. “We’ll leave when I say we’ll leave.”
My mother taught me weight control. “Don’t get to big for your britches!”
My mother taught me modesty.“Hands to your side- that skirt is too short, go back upstairs and change.”
My mother taught me less is more. –“Go upstairs and wipe that red lipstick, glitter eyeshadow and black eyeliner off your face.”
My mother taught me to believe in magic.“I’ve got eyes in the back of my head.”
